CSS Auto Hide Elements After 5 Seconds
The question arises: is it feasible to conceal an element five seconds after the page loads? A jQuery solution is known, but the intention is to replicate it using CSS transition. Is it possible, or is it beyond the capabilities of CSS transition/animation?
The Answer
The answer is a resounding yes! However, it cannot be accomplished in the expected manner because animating or transitioning the properties typically used to conceal an element (such as display or altering dimensions and setting to overflow: hidden) is not possible.
Instead, an animation is created for the relevant elements. After five seconds, visibility: hidden; is toggled, while height and width are set to zero to prevent the element from occupying space in the DOM flow.
Example Code
CSS
html, body { height:100%; width:100%; margin:0; padding:0; } #hideMe { -moz-animation: cssAnimation 0s ease-in 5s forwards; /* Firefox */ -webkit-animation: cssAnimation 0s ease-in 5s forwards; /* Safari and Chrome */ -o-animation: cssAnimation 0s ease-in 5s forwards; /* Opera */ animation: cssAnimation 0s ease-in 5s forwards; -webkit-animation-fill-mode: forwards; animation-fill-mode: forwards; } @keyframes cssAnimation { to { width:0; height:0; overflow:hidden; } } @-webkit-keyframes cssAnimation { to { width:0; height:0; visibility:hidden; } }
HTML
<div></div>

Choosing Flexbox or Grid depends on the layout requirements: 1) Flexbox is suitable for one-dimensional layouts, such as navigation bar; 2) Grid is suitable for two-dimensional layouts, such as magazine layouts. The two can be used in the project to improve the layout effect.
